Mr. William Fred Nesbitt, 90, a lifelong resident of Gordon County, died Thursday, March 1, 2018, at Hamilton Medical Center, following several months declining health. Fred was born in Gordon County on January 10, 1928, son of the late Marion Buford Nesbitt and Lois Isabelle Lance Nesbitt.
Fred was a member of the 1948 graduating class of Calhoun High School. He was a veteran of the United States Air Force, having served from 1951 to 1955. He attained the rank of Staff Sergeant, and was awarded the National Defense Service Medal. He was a faithful member of Calhoun First Baptist Church since 1948. Fred loved his church and enjoyed spending time with his family and many friends. He was retired from Georgia Textile Corporation.
He is survived by his loving wife, Ruth Griffin Nesbitt, to whom he was married for 60 years; his son, Lenny Nesbitt of Calhoun; granddaughters, Allison Nesbitt of Calhoun and Amy Nesbitt Underwood and her husband Jason of Calhoun; brother-in-law, Eugene Griffin and his wife Gwen of Rockmart, and Donnie and Tracie Nesbitt of Calhoun; along with many other relatives.
